Tour the wildlife world with me as I share some of my best images. We will visit polar bears in the North Pole sea ice and penguins in Antarctica, snow monkeys in the Japanese Alps, jaguars in the jungles of Brazil and their brethren from the Serengeti of Africa. We will soar with our feathered friends of Central America, Asia, as well as snowy owls from Canada. And we will not forget the rest of North America. Meanwhile, I will be relating the story behind the shot in addition to some photographic considerations.
About Steve Upton
I am a self taught wildlife and nature photographer. Although I bought my first serious camera gear in 2007, I didn?t really start developing my craft until retirement around 2010. To me, the beauty of photography is that one never stops learning and evolving. This allows us to capture mesmerizing moments in nature that most will never see. Sharing these magnificent events is why I drag my gear to some of the most remote regions of the planet. Showing why something needs to be cared for is so much more powerful than simply banging a drum.
Printing my own work at my studio and gallery gives me great pleasure and a sense of start to finish accomplishment. Much of my work is large format printed on canvas, and although I only have a couple of public gallery openings a year, I am always willing to open privately for show and tell if I am not on the road.
